酷代码 AI
菜单
服务商

彻底禁止嵌入页面上下滚动:代码修改方案及注意要点

要禁止嵌入页面的滚动,需要修改iframe的属性和样式。以下是修正后的代码: ```html <div style="margin: 0; padding: 0; overflow: hidden;"> <iframe style="pointer-events: none; width: 100%; height: 99%; border: none; overflow: hidden;" id="mapIframe" name="mapIframe" src="http://hot.icfqs.com:7615/site/tdx-pc-bk-pages/page-ailtxb.html?color=0&bkcolor=000000" scrolling="no"> </iframe> </div> ``` 关键修改点: 1. 添加了`scrolling="no"`属性禁止滚动条 2. 移除了`marginwidth`和`marginheight`等过时属性 3. 添加了`overflow: hidden`样式 4. 修正了iframe标签未闭合的问题 三条额外需要注意的逻辑点: 1. 某些现代浏览器可能忽略`scrolling="no"`,此时需要配合CSS的`overflow: hidden`使用 2. `pointer-events: none`会禁用所有鼠标事件,确保这是你想要的效果 3. 如果嵌入页面本身有滚动逻辑,可能需要通过postMessage与父页面通信来完全禁用滚动 ######[AI写代码神器 | 281点数解答 | 2025-06-19 22:08:22]

相关提问
本站限时免费提问中
实用工具查看更多
Linux在线手册 [开发类]
Jquery在线手册 [开发类]
今日油价 [生活类]
图片互转base64 [开发类]
时间转换器 [开发类]